Claims (1)
- 【特許請求の範囲】 1. 電気アクチュエータ(8)によって駆動されると共にクランク(15A)を持 つクランク機構(15)に作用する駆動シャフト(13)を備え、連接棒(16)が偏 心的に上記クランク(15A)と接続され、対応するシリンダ(20)内で可動なピ ストン(17)を上記連接棒(16)が支持するモータ駆動圧縮機において、 上記シリンダ(20)内の上記ピストン(17)の少なくとも一部の行程中に、上 記ピストン(17)を支持する上記連接棒(16)が上記クランク(15A)の存在す る平面を横切る長手方向の軸(K)を持つように、上記シリンダ(20)は90°以 外の角度(α)で上記駆動シャフト(13)の軸(X)に対して傾斜されている長手方 向の軸(W)を持っていることを特徴とするモータ駆動圧縮機。 2. 請求項1に記載のモータ駆動圧縮機において、上記連接棒(16)は対応す る玉継手(19,30)によって上記ピストン(17)と上記クランク(15A)に接 続されていることを特徴とするモータ駆動圧縮機。 3. 請求項2に記載のモータ駆動圧縮機において、上記連接棒(16A)の小端 部と協働する上記玉継手(19)は上記クランク(15A)内に偏心的に形成された 座(29)と連合されていることを特徴とするモータ駆動圧縮機。 4. 請求項1に記載のモータ駆動圧縮機において、上記シリンダ(20)は圧縮 機ボディ(26)と連合されているシリンダボディ(40)を備え、このシリンダボ ディ(40)は上記連接棒(16)が中で動くチャンバ(43)を持ち、上記駆動シャ フト(13)内に長手方向に設けられると共にケーシング(2)の内部の空所(5)の 下部領域(5A)に入っているパイプ(13C)に接続されているダクト(13A)を 少なくとも用いて上記チャンバは上記モータ駆動圧縮機(1)の上記ケーシング( 2)の内部の上記空所(5)と連通していることを特徴とするモータ駆動圧縮機。 5. 請求項4に記載のモータ駆動圧縮機において、ダクト(44)は上記駆動シ ャフト(13)内の上記ダクト(13A)に接続されていると共に上記座(29)とつ ながり、上記座(29)内では上記連接棒(16A)の上記小端部と連合されている 上記玉継手(19)が配置されていることを特徴とするモータ駆動圧縮機。 6. 請求項1に記載のモータ駆動圧縮機において、上記クランク(15A)は上 記圧縮機ボディ(26)内の各座(26A)に配置された機械的結合部材(21)上で 動くことを特徴とするモータ駆動圧縮機。 7. 請求項4に記載のモータ駆動圧縮機において、上記シリンダボディ(40) は上記圧縮機ボディ(26)と連合されているフランジ付きの端部(41)を持っい ることを特徴とするモータ駆動圧縮機。 8. 請求項7に記載のモータ駆動圧縮機において、上記圧縮機ボディ(26)は コップ状に成形され、上記電気アクチュエータ(8)の一部(8A)を収容する側壁 (56)を持ち、上記壁(56)は上記アクチュエータ(8)の傍に配置された螺子付 き接合要素(55)によって上記アクチュエータ(8)の下に配置された支持部材( 6)と協働することを特徴とするモータ駆動圧縮機。
